Understanding Hero Leadership and Why It Fails

Hero leadership is a system where teams depend on the leader for problem solving.

Initially it creates a sense of control and reliability.

Eventually teams stop thinking independently.

Why Teams Become Dependent on Leaders

Many leaders believe they are helping their teams by being involved in everything.

But the system creates a different outcome.

  • Teams hesitate without leadership input
  • Responsibility stays with the leader
  • Scaling becomes impossible

This is a structural problem not a motivation problem.
